Australian Prime Minister Scott Morrison has set an example of sportsmanship. During the practice match, the Prime Minister did the work which everyone was surprised to see.
Actually, before the series between Australia and Sri Lanka, Sri Lanka was facing Prime Minister XI. While the batting of Sri Lankan team, Australian Prime Minister Morrison brought drinks to the ground for his team.

All the players on the field were surprised to see this work of the Prime Minister. PM Scott Morrison also went to the ground and shook hands with the players. However, against Sri Lanka, Prime Minister XI’s team won the match by one wicket.
In this match, Sri Lanka batting first scored 131 runs at the loss of 8 wickets in 20 overs with the help of Oshada Fernando (38) and Vanindu Hasranga (26). In response, Australia won the match due to the brilliant half-century innings of Prime Minister XI’s team Harry Nilsson (79). Let us tell that the series of three T20 matches between Sri Lanka and Australia will be played from October 27. The second match of this series will be played on 30th and the last match on 1st November.
